Buying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ies in Turkmenistan is a relatively simple process that can be completed through a reputable cryptocurrency exchange. Here are the steps to follow:
Choose a cryptocurrency exchange: You need to find a cryptocurrency exchange that operates in Turkmenistan. Some popular options include Binance, Kraken, and Coinbase.
Create an account: Once you have chosen an exchange, you will need to create an account. This typically involves providing your name, email address, and a form of identification, such as a passport or national ID card.
Verify your account: You will need to verify your account by providing additional information, such as your address and a photo of yourself holding your ID.
Fund your account: You can typically fund your account using a bank transfer, credit/debit card, or other payment methods accepted by the exchange.
Purchase B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ies: Once your account is funded, you can purchase B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ies by placing an order on the exchange. You can choose to buy at the current market price or set a limit order at a specific price.
Secure your cryptocurrency: It is important to store your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ies securely. You can store them in a digital wallet provided by the exchange or transfer them to a hardware wallet for added security.
Please note that cryptocurrency regulations in Turkmenistan are currently unclear, and the government has not officially recognized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ies as legal tender. As a result, it is important to do your own research and exercise caution when buying and trading cryptocurrencies in Turkmenistan.
